Output ebd74b7935bc5374b81e6560ea55dc86201c9b5c40c9f9cd5f54a724eff82656:1

value
4063386
script pubkey
OP_0 OP_PUSHBYTES_20 c4d53f07deae60e4a6123766fcdbd80263aa7957
address
bc1qcn2n7p774eswffsjxan0ek7cqf36572hgnde59
transaction
ebd74b7935bc5374b81e6560ea55dc86201c9b5c40c9f9cd5f54a724eff82656